Alright so I don't know if you have read my review on the Catrice made to stay inside eye higlighter pen, but this eyeliner is gorgeous! It doesn't really add colour but it does make your eyes brighter and makes you look more awake.
I've been using it for a week now and I can honestly say I see the difference when I don't use it. 

Next I have the eyeliner pencil that I used for my weekly make-uplook challenge update. It's from a limited edition by Catrice called "Colours of the ocean" and it has two sides: a silver one and a green one. Not bad!

Next I have all my Essence eyeliners. I'm going to go from top to bottom using the picture above. Below, you can see the swatches.

The first eyeliner by Essence (the blue one) is called "Cool down", next we have "Check me out", followed by "Hola, chika!" and "Nightfever". The white eyeliner, which I also use as a base for eyeshadow often, is called "White" (surprise, surprise).
